IIRC, as long as you have parameters that need to be entered, you will get that behavior everytime you use the CR refresh button. Even if you supply default values this will happen.
We do not allow refreshing ( we do not show the 'lightning bolt' button on the viewer) for that very reason; we ask that the user run the report again ( our setup enables this by using the browser's back button to return to the page that prompts for parameters..the old values are still there , so a click on the view button refreshes the data or new values can be chosen - it is set to refresh on every print).
If your report is already set up to use an ODBC DSN, then you need to call the LogOnServer method. Using the sample you downloaded, the following is all of the necessary code to logon and preview a report from an ODBC data source in the Image40_Click() event ('Refresh Report'):
[tt]
Set crxReport = Nothing
Set crxReport = crxApplication.OpenReport(MyReportFile)
crxReport.Database.LogOnServer "p2sodbc.dll", "DSN_Name", "DB_Name", "UserID", "Password"
Me!CRViewer1.ReportSource = crxReport
Me!CRViewer1.ViewReport
[/tt]
The same code (minus the first line) would also go into the Image35_Click() event ('View').
To set parameters within the code as opposed to the Crystal parameter window:
[tt]
'Set a String parameter
crxReport.ParameterFields.GetItemByName("Country").AddCurrentValue "Argentina"
'Set a Date Range parameter
crxReport.ParameterFields.GetItemByName("DateRange").AddCurrentRange CDate("6/1/04"), CDate("6/29/04"), 3
[/tt]

Open up the report in the Crystal designer, and go to Database>Convert Database Driver. What driver is it using (it'll be grayed out)? Whatever it says, that's the first argument you should be passing to the LogOnServer method. You don't need the path (or at least you shouldn't).
What happens when you use pass pdsodbc.dll (or p2sodbc.dll)? Are you getting an error?
As far as I know, all ODBC connections with Crystal connect through pdsodbc.dll or p2sodbc.dll. It then communicates with the driver that was used when the DSN was created to access the server. If you want to learn more about it, check out this document:
